backyard
noun /ˌbækˈjɑːd/
/ˌbækˈjɑːrd/
Idioms - (North American English) the whole area behind and belonging to a house, including an area of grass and the garden
- He grew vegetables in his backyard.
- a backyard barbecue
- (British English) an area with a hard surface behind a house, often surrounded by a wall
- They lived in a little terraced house with a backyard behind it and a tiny garden in front.

Idioms
in your (own) backyard
- in or near the place where you live or work
- The residents didn't want a new factory in their backyard.
- The party leader is facing opposition in his own backyard (= from his own members).
